Apart from a handful of minibuses and the big autorickshaws that could accommodate a dozen passengers (and long distance trains, of course), public transport is scarce between Varanasi and Saranath. But the wary traveller doesn't need a route map on the road to Saranath. Houses, shops, gates, billboards...everything features a familiar leitmotif - Ashoka Chakra, the wheel with 24 spokes.
